Product Specification

Panel Thickness 2" 2-1/2" 3" 4" 5" 6"
R-Value 7.5 per inch
Panel Width 24" 30" 36" 42" (standard)
Lengths 8'-0" to 52'-0"
Joint Configuration Double tongue and groove interlocking rainscreen joint
Reveals Standard 1/8" vertical application, standard 3/8" horizontal application
Exterior Face 26, 24, 22 Ga. Mini-Wave profiled embossed G-90 galvanized or Galvalume™ pre-painted steel
Interior Face 26 Ga. Shadowline profiled embossed G-90 galvanized or Galvalume® pre-painted steel
Orientation Horizontal or Vertical
Product Code KS42MW

Sustainable Benefits of Mini-Wave

  • Energy efficiency. IMPs have a core of continuous, rigid insulation for industry leading R- and U- values with superior airtightness performance.
  • Indoor environmental quality. IMPs help ensure a stable interior environment.
  • Recycled and Recyclable. The exterior skins contain a substantial amount of recycled content, and the panels themselves are recyclable.
  • Recycled, low-weight materials. Made with recaptured metals, IMPs weigh only 3 pounds per square foot, reducing transport and installation energy.
  • Eased construction. IMPs are simple to detail and attach, reducing schedules and installation errors.
  • Life-cycle benefits. IMPs last as long as the service life of a typical commercial building. The durable panels also reduce operational costs for energy and maintenance, and offer multiple end-of-life reuse options.
  • Building certification and green targets. IMPs contribute to LEED certification programs and the path to Net-Zero Energy targets.
